How to Increase Your Google Adsense CPC (Cost Per Click) in Less Than 2 Minutes

Google Adsense has a great feature called Competitive Ad Filters which allows you to block advertisements from specific advertisers. This allows you to prevent advertisers that pays dirt cheap from showing on your site.

If you have been using Google Adsense then you have probably experienced seeing something like 1 click that earned you only 1 cent which is really frustrating.
